How to get here
Airport: The best way from Glasgow Airport to the city centre is by Glasgow Express Bus number 500, £8.50 . The bus travel time from Glasgow Airport to Glasgow city centre is around 20 minutes. Taxis are plentiful and are adjacent to the exit doors. The taxi fare from Glasgow airport to Glasgow city centre/University of Glasgow is around £25.
Train: The two main railway stations in Glasgow are Central Station and Queen Street Station, between the two of them they provide connections to not only the rest of Scotland but also almost anywhere in the UK, including direct links to London. Glasgow Queen Street Train Station has a linked walkway to Buchanan Street Subway. Both stations have taxi ranks within a minute’s walk from the station.
Subway: The Subway is the easiest way to get around the City Centre and West End of Glasgow. Running every four minutes at peak times, it takes just 24 minutes to complete a circuit of the fifteen stations. Alight at Hillhead for University Of Glasgow. It is approximately 0.5 miles from the Hillhead subway station to the James Watt Building.

Accommodation
The University of Glasgow is situated in the West End, with a variety of small hotels and guest houses nearby, as well as links to the City Centre hotels by Subway. The closest Subway station to the main University campus is Hillhead and the closest stations for the City Centre are Buchanan Street and St. Enoch. Hotels near these stations are suggested below.
